Updated Monday, June 8, 2009 9:48 am TWN, The China Post news staff Ma Ying-jeou all set to double as KMT chairmanOther candidate hopefuls will have to obtain the application form starting Tuesday next week, sources said. Ma will be the first one to receive it, sources added. On the same day, sources said, Ma is expected to have a regular party-government “summit” at his office to announce his candidacy. Participants in that summit meeting are Premier Liu Chao-shiuan, Legislative Yuan president Wang Jin-pyng and Kuomintang chairman Wu Poh-hsiung. Wu will announce his retirement at the meeting, sources revealed. His current term expires on September 12. The president doesn't want to run unopposed. So an also-ran will have to be chosen, Kuomintang sources pointed out. Both Ma and the also-ran must produce enough endorsement for candidacy and Kuomintang members are scheduled to go to the polls to elect their new chairman on July 26.
